“Fantastic cottage in the amazing Peak District”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 14 January 2012

My husband and I stayed at Wheeldon Trees Farm for 3 nights in November 2011 in the Ollerenshaw cottage which was perfect for the two of us and our young labrador. The cottage was immaculate and stocked with everything you could need for the perfect self catering holiday, we were very impressed with the standard of the cottage - the kitchen was modern, the bathroom luxurious and the bedroom very comfortable. The owners, Deborah and Martin, were very friendly and helped us out a number of times when we had random questions!

The setting is amazing, in the heart of the Peak District. From the moment we stepped foot outside of our cottage all we could see was rolling hills, a sprinkling of sheep, and fortunately for us in November, blue sky! We did a number of the walks to surrounding villages which were lovely (route maps are in all of the cottages). We also took in day trips to Bakewell, Chatsworth House (great day out but the house was still hidden under scaffolding), Lyme Hall & White Peak National Trust - all of which we would recommend.

We ate at a couple of the local pubs - the Royal Oak and the Packhorse Inn. Both offer delicious home cooked food.

We would highly recommend Wheeldon Trees Farm and will definitely be visiting again in the future.

“Perfect New Year!”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 11 January 2012

The biggest testimony we can give Wheeldon Trees is that this was our fifth stay in the cottages! Despite that this is the first time we have stayed for a full week, previously only having long weekends.
This was our first stay in Mycock Cottage but we knew what to expect from the property as they are all similar & all perfect. It was plenty big enough for us both & our 5 year old daughter (& Gordon setter Rudy) & the tasteful Xmas decorations gave it a lovely festive feel, nice little extras like a christmas cake & a bottle of prosecco were an extra new year bonus too.
I have previously reviewed Wheeldon Trees & can only echo those feelings, it's a great setting, the cottages are beautifully furnished & equipped & Martin & Deborah are the perfect hosts. I genuinely think they have thought of everything, the long room is packed full of toys & games for all ages, the store has full laundry facilities, stock of prepared meals & other useful kitchen items. It also has a lovely Eco feel as recycling almost everything is encouraged & so easy to do.
As you might expect in the Peak District the weather in late December/early January is not always glorious but we found plenty to do locally despite it being New Year & we were so glad we had the full week. Pantomime at the opera house was a festive must, Poole's Cavern was a fun day, nice wander at Chatsworth House & plenty of walks locally round the cottage, the bookshop down the road was great for a stock up of reading material too. We must also recommend a meal at the Royal Oak, we've been every time we've stayed at Wheeldon & always been impressed. The menu is vast, the food lovely & I defy anyone to get through 3 courses! we've never made it to dessert yet!
Wheeldon Trees was the perfect treat after a hectic build up to Christmas & we left feeling fully rested, recuperated & ready for 2012, we just need to work out when we are returning for visit no.6
